Everton are without a win in their last six games in all competitions heading into the Premier League clash against West Brom at Goodison Park on Saturday.

The Toffees have been in rotten form but no side has taken fewer points on the road this season than West Brom.

Everton are still looking for their first win of 2018 having last their last game games.

Sam Allardyce’s side will be looking to bounce back from a 4-0 defeat against Tottenham at Wembley last week but have reason to be optimistic.

Big Sam will have a new look ‘fab four’ to select heading into the game following the arrival of Theo Walcott form Arsenal.

Cenk Tosun is almost certain to start his first game at Goodison Park after his big money move from Besiktas.

Tosun was left isolated up front against Spurs. The additional of Walcott should strengthen Everton’s attack and provide Tosun with more support.

The Turkey international believes he will link up well with Walcott.

“Theo is a great player,” Tosun said. “He’s a proven player and has done well for Arsenal for many years. I would say it’d be a massive signing for us.

“I think I would link up well with him. We already have very talented players in our team and I’m sure if we sign him he would have a great input.”

Wayne Rooney is likely to start behind Tosun with Sigurdsson out wide.

Yannick Bolasie would be sacrificed for Walcott or Sigurdsson as things stand but he remains an option – especially if Allardyce wants to focus on pace.

Schneiderlin is likely to return to the side after not starting against Tottenham, while Gueye is expected to keep his place in central midfield.

Pickford is set to start in goal, Maarten Stekelenburg remains a doubt.

The defensive four is likely to be comprised of Cuco Martina and Kenny as full-backs while Jagielka and Ashley Williams could get the nod as the centre-back pairing.

Allardyce will be without defensive players Seamus Coleman and Leighton Baines who are sidelined while Michael Keane remains a doubt.
